Overview
Revive the timeless sound of the '70s with the Vintera II 70s Stratocaster and experience the iconic looks, inspiring feel, and incomparable tone that only a Fender can deliver.
The Vintera II 70s Stratocaster features an alder body and a maple neck with maple or rosewood fingerboard for classic Fender tone that's full of punch and clarity. The "U"-shape neck is based on the classic '70s profile and offers a remarkably comfy feel, while the 7.25" radius fingerboard with vintage-tall frets provides vintage comfort with ample room for big bends and expressive vibrato. Under the hood, you'll find a trio of vintage-style '70s pickups that deliver all the sweet and sparkling, warm and woody tone that made Fender famous. The vintage-style synchronized tremolo lets you dive and wail with abandon, while vintage-style "F"-stamped tuning machines provide classic looks with a finer gear ratio and enhanced tuning stability to complete the package.

Specs
-Series: Vintera II
-Model Name: Vintera II 70s Stratocaster
-Body Material: Alder
-Body Finish: Gloss Polyester
-Color: 3-Color Sunburst
-Neck: Maple, '70s "U"
-Neck Finish: Gloss Urethane
-Fingerboard: Maple 7.25" (184.1 mm)
-Frets: 21, Vintage Tall
-Position Inlays: Black Dot
-Nut (Material/Width): Synthetic Bone, 1.650" (42 mm)
-Tuning Machines: Fender Vintage "F" Stamped
-Scale Length: 25.5" (64.77 cm)
-Bridge: 6-Saddle Vintage-Style Synchronized Tremolo with Bent Steel Saddles
-Pickguard: 3-Ply Black/White/Black
-Pickups: Vintage-Style '70s Single-Coil Strat (Bridge, Middle, Neck)
-Pickup Switching: 5-Position Blade: Position 1. Bridge Pickup, Position 2. Bridge and Middle Pickup, Position 3. Middle Pickup, Position 4. Middle and Neck Pickup, Position 5. Neck Pickup
-Controls: Master Volume, Tone 1. (Neck/Middle Pickups), Tone 2. (Bridge Pickup)
-Control Knobs: Aged White Plastic
-Hardware Finish: Nickel/Chrome
-Strings: Fender USA 250L Nickel Plated Steel (.009-.042 Gauges)
-Case/Gig Bag: Included Deluxe Gig Bag

I don’t know what is going on with Fender.Their QC has a mind of its own and lacks supervision.First Fed Ex delivered this guitar to a house other than mine ,on a street other than mine.I had to study the picture of the porch it was left on and drive around till I found it because Fed Ex sure wasn’t gonna help me find it.I let it acclimate and opened it.I got excited immediately when felt the weight and saw the neck has this almost roasted like tint to it and gorgeous grain.Then noticed the fret sprout on the treble side and had a issue where it was cutting out bends really bad.No matter how hard I tried it would not hold a tune,if you almost got it in tune,was out as soon as you hit a chord or lick on it and if you bent a note forget it.At first I thought great the nut needs to be replaced.After taking back plate off the claw was a real mess.The most out of whack ,lopsided tremolo claw I’ve ever seen. zZounds made me a offer if I wanted to keep it or return it and I took it to a luthier and they fixed the fret issues.I probably should have e returned it but I love the neck profile,the tint ,the weight.Now it’s become a pretty cool guitar and I do think this is probably Fenders best line,far better than most the American series.
